Job Description:We are building tomorrow's bank today, requiring world-class engineers to modernize and rebuild our legacy monolithic environment over the next few years.The OpportunityThis is a significant opportunity to help rebuild the craft of engineering at Commbank, influence our culture, and do important, impactful engineering at scale that will make a material difference to our customers, employees, and the community.The RoleWe are looking for exceptional senior software engineers to join our multi-year enterprise transformation program.Key Objectives:Enhance Customer Value: Unlock dependable digital experiences that meet customer objectives.Increase Delivery Velocity: Unwind complex legacy architecture to enable faster delivery and greater autonomy.Always Available Channels: Simplify technology foundations to provide seamless, always-available channels.What We OfferWe support flexible working arrangements, including in-office connections, flexible start and finish times, part-time arrangements, and job sharing. We're interested in hearing from people who can balance work and life effectively.RequirementsWe're seeking individuals with experience in the full software development lifecycle, focusing on excellent UX, CI/CD, automated testing, infrastructure cloud pipelines, logging, and monitoring. Key skills include:Developing 3-tier applications on-premises and in the cloud (Frontend: React or TypeScript; Backend: C# .NET Core, Java, NodeJS; Database: SQL and NoSQL).Infrastructure as code using CloudFormation or Terraform.Microservices design and implementation of highly scalable APIs.At least one scripting/programming language (e.g., JavaScript, TypeScript, Go, Python).CI/CD tools (e.g., GitHub Actions, TeamCity, Octopus).Automated Quality Engineering and Testing (Unit Testing, Regression Testing).Working with UsOur people bring diverse backgrounds and perspectives to build a respectful, inclusive, and flexible workplace with flexible work locations. We value innovation, teamwork, and security, and we're keen to support you in your career journey.